使用自签名证书时,“服务器的证书与URL不匹配”

qui*_*ack 5 iis-7 self-signed ssl-certificate

我一直在尝试使用自签名证书配置在本地服务器上部署的网站,以用于开发目的。我希望我的网站工作的地址是example.company.local。使用SelfSSL生成证书后,将其复制到“个人”和“受信任的证书”根目录下的“本地计算机”存储中。但是,当我尝试访问URL时,出现错误“服务器的证书与URL不匹配”。尽管我可以忽略它,但我知道证书身份验证失败,并且我想解决此问题。我正在列出我遵循的步骤

  1. 使用生成了自签名证书selfssl /N:CN=example.company.local /V:9999。这会将证书添加到我在本地计算机上的个人存储中
  2. 从mmc(在“运行”中键入mmc),将上面生成的证书添加到“个人”文件夹中的“受信任的根证书”文件夹中
  3. 重新启动IIS

请建议我要去哪里错了。我提供的网址是https://example.company.local,但它指向本地主机证书。

pep*_*epo 2

请尝试本指南。从页面上的评论来看,它似乎有效,但我没有测试它。

如果通过任何更改仍然存在问题,我建议使用xca。它构建在 openssl 之上,具有非常漂亮的 GUI,并具有 CA、SSL 服务器和 SSL 客户端的模板。可以在此处找到文档。